What is a Betting System?
Sports Betting Systems Explained
Sports betting systems are tactical methods for placing bets and managing finances. These organized systems utilize various patterns, guidelines, and calculations to guide how much to wager, which matches to bet on, and how to handle winning or losing outcomes.
By adhering to these systems, bettors are able to make more informed and consistent decisions regarding their wagers. Even the simplest strategies can foster discipline in your betting behavior.

Common Strategies in Sports Betting: What Techniques Do Professionals Use?
Betting strategies are tailored for various gamblers, from cautious newbies to experienced pros. Here are five prominent systems, outlining their distinct attributes and practical uses.
The Martingale Betting System
The Martingale System This strategy entails bettors doubling their stake following each loss in order to recover prior losses and generate a profit. It's most suitable for those with a substantial bankroll, particularly effective with even-money bets such as totals or spreads. However, novices may lack the financial cushion to manage such risks.
The Labouchere System
The Labouchere system This approach follows a negative progression system that divides target earnings into smaller units. Bettors adjust their stake based on wins or losses, creating a more organized method for recovering their bankroll. This strategy presents moderate risk and is best suited for disciplined bettors who excel at tracking their progress. It's particularly effective in sports like soccer, where close contests are frequent and bets are made with careful calculation.
The Fibonacci System
Like the Martingale, the Fibonacci system Similar to previous strategies, this system increases betting amounts following losses. However, it does so in a gradual manner, making it ideal for those wary of risk or who have a smaller budget. Utilizing the well-known Fibonacci sequence, this system is most effective for even-money bets and is suitable for sports that exhibit predictable patterns, such as tennis or basketball.
The Paroli System (known as Reverse Martingale or Anti-Martingale System)
The Paroli is a positive progression system aimed at capitalizing on winning streaks. Bettors double their wager after each win and revert to the initial bet after achieving three consecutive victories. This low-risk strategy is attractive to beginners and risk-averse players, proving most effective for bets with even odds, like totals in basketball or soccer.
The Kelly Criterion System
The Kelly Criterion This method calculates the best stake based on the perceived likelihood of success. Bettors assign a portion of their bankroll relative to the value of the bet in order to maximize long-term growth potential. It applies to all sports, particularly in situations where odds examination is key.
How to Develop Your Personalized Betting System
Crafting your personal betting system allows for a customized approach to wagering; however, it also carries risks without meticulous planning. Follow these guidelines to create a strategy that balances your aims, resources, and betting style.

Lay the Groundwork with Statistical Analysis
A solid betting system is rooted in data analysis. Examine past performance data, trends, and odds to uncover patterns and potential opportunities. Tools such as spreadsheets or sports analytics software can help ensure your strategy remains data-driven.
Choose a Sport or League to Center Your Approach Around
Concentrate on a sport or league you are knowledgeable about. Understanding team behaviors, player performances, and unique scheduling quirks can provide a competitive advantage. Focusing on niche leagues like college basketball or lesser-known soccer leagues may reveal valuable insights.
Draw Inspiration from Established Strategies
Investigate notable systems such as the Martingale or Kelly Criterion to understand their strengths and limitations. You can modify these proven techniques to align with your personal aspirations, thereby avoiding unnecessary trials and errors.

Share Ideas and Strategies Online
Engaging with online betting communities encourages feedback and insights regarding your system. Sharing your strategy through forums or social media can help identify areas for improvement or validate your approach.
Consider Your Approach to Risk
Decide if you want to concentrate on gradual growth, akin to flat betting, or pursue high-risk, high-reward plays, like the Martingale. Make sure your system aligns with your bankroll size and risk tolerance to prevent emotional decision-making.
